Understanding YouTube’s Parental Controls

YouTube offers a range of parental control features that allow you to monitor and restrict the content your child can access. These features include content restrictions, age-gate, and screen time management. By understanding these features, you can create a customized experience for your child that aligns with your family’s values and preferences.

Step-by-Step Guide to Setting Up Parental Controls on YouTube

1. Create a YouTube Account: To enable parental controls, you need a YouTube account. If you don’t have one, sign up for a free account at https://www.youtube.com.

2. Turn on YouTube Kids: YouTube Kids is a dedicated app designed specifically for children. It offers a more controlled environment with curated content and parental control features. Download the YouTube Kids app from your device’s app store and sign in with your YouTube account.

3. Set Up Parental Controls: Once you have signed in to YouTube Kids, go to the settings menu. Under the “Parental Settings” section, you will find options to enable content restrictions, block certain channels, and manage screen time.

4. Enable Content Restrictions: To restrict the type of content your child can access, enable content restrictions. You can choose to block videos that contain inappropriate content, such as violence, profanity, or mature themes.

5. Age-Gate: YouTube Kids uses age gates to prevent children from accessing videos that are not suitable for their age. Set the appropriate age for your child to ensure they only see age-appropriate content.

6. Manage Screen Time: You can set a daily screen time limit for your child to encourage a healthy balance between online activities and other aspects of life.

7. Monitor Activity: Regularly check your child’s YouTube Kids activity to ensure they are staying within the boundaries you have set. You can view their search history, watch history, and favorite videos.

Additional Tips for Enhancing Internet Safety

1. Communicate with Your Child: Discuss the importance of internet safety with your child and explain the reasons behind the parental controls you have set up.

2. Educate About Online Predators: Teach your child about the dangers of online predators and how to identify and report suspicious behavior.

3. Use Other Parental Control Tools: Consider using other parental control tools, such as filtering software or monitoring apps, to provide an additional layer of protection.

4. Stay Updated: Keep yourself informed about the latest trends and threats in the online world to ensure you can adapt your parental controls accordingly.
